Well, the basics are as follows:
1st Generation:
SA - 1979-1980 Production RX-7
FB - 1981-1985 Production RX-7
2nd Generation
FC - 1986-1992 Production RX-7
3rd Generation
FD - 1993+ Production RX-7
RX-8
FE - 2004+ Production RX-8

Each generation also breaks down into different series' as well, here are those year cut-offs:

Series 1 or S1 - 1979-1980 RX-7
Series 2 or S2 - 1981-1983 RX-7
Series 3 or S3 - 1984-1985 RX-7
Series 4 or S4 - 1986-1988 RX-7
Series 5 or S5 - 1989-1992 RX-7
Series 6 or S6 - 1993+ RX-7

It may need some.... improvement... but it was Mazda's first crack at the Rx7... Over the couple years the 1st gen was made, they gave it a bigger gas tank, rear disc brakes, suspension upgrades, and a couple other things.

But as you can see by CHEF's car, they can easily be improved upon to get wehre you want 'em.

I wouldn't want the headache of trying to figure out all the differences and find parts for it though... So many tiny little things changed that it's damn near impossible to find some of the specific little parts.
